XhCode オンライン コンバータ ツール

CSVはunescapeを逃がします

CSV Escape Unescapeツールは、ブラウザによって解釈されないCSVを直接出力する場合に、CSV文字列をエスケープして無効にするのに役立ちます。



結果:
CSVエスケープUNESCAPEオンラインコンバーターツール

CSVエスケープ/アンエスケープとは?

  • エスケープ: 特殊文字(カンマ、引用符、改行など)がCSV構造を崩さないようにデータを変更するプロセス。通常は、値を引用符で囲み、内部の引用符をエスケープします。

  • アンエスケープ: 逆のプロセス。CSVファイルの読み取り時に、エスケープされた値を元の形式に戻します。


CSVエスケープ/アンエスケープを使用する理由

  • フィールドにカンマ、改行、引用符が含まれている場合に、データの整合性を維持するため。

  • CSVパーサーが正しく読み取りと分割を実行できるようにするため。値を列に入力します。

  • システム間でのインポート/エクスポート中にデータ破損を防ぐため。


CSV のエスケープ/アンエスケープの使用方法

  • エスケープ規則(ほとんどの CSV 形式に共通):

    • フィールドにカンマ、引用符、または改行が含まれている場合は、二重引用符で囲みます。

    • 内部の二重引用符は、二重引用符を二重にしてエスケープします(" は "" になります)。

  • アンエスケープ:

    • インポート/エクスポート中に、周囲の引用符を削除し、二重引用符を一重引用符に戻します。

  • ほとんどのプログラミング言語では、これを自動的に処理するライブラリを使用します。

    • Python: csv モジュール

    • Java: OpenCSV または Apache Commons CSV

    • .NET: TextFieldParser または CSVHelper


CSV エスケープ/アンエスケープを使用するタイミング

  • 複雑なデータやフォーマットされたデータを含む CSV ファイルを読み書きする場合。

  • CSV ファイルを エクスポート/インポート する場合データベース、スプレッドシート、またはアプリケーション。

  • カンマ、引用符、または改行文字を含む可能性のあるレポートまたはログを自動化する場合。

  • CSVデータの手動またはプログラムによる解析が必要な場合。